Viktor Axelsen of Denmark and Tai Tzu Ying of Chinese Taipei have won the men’s and women’s singles title respectively at All England Championship. All England Championship was held in Birmingham, England. This was the last badminton event before the Badminton World Federation’s suspension of all tournaments due to the coronavirus pandemic.
Viktor Axelsen of Denmark defeated Chinese Taipei’s Chou Tien-chen by 21-13, 21-14 to win the men’s singles title of All England Championship.
Tai Tzu Ying of Chinese Taipei defeated Chinese Chen Yu Fei by 21-19, 21-15 to win the women’s singles title of All England Championship. This was third title win at All England Championship for Tai Tzu Ying.
